Plant Biology
(Chapters 10, 35, 36, 37, 38, 39)

Plants, one of the five kingdoms of living organisms, are a significant contributor to the base of the food chain. The process by which these autotrophs capture energy from the sun and convert it into a chemical form, photosynthesis, is one of the most important metabolic processes upon which all life depends. After examining this important process the basics of plant anatomy and physiology are explored.
